Anyone know the Iridiums that have been deorbited? Or, more specifically, anyone know the status of 61, 10, 14, and 32? 32 is the most important to me as it'll be giving a bright flare near where I am soon...

[edit] and 84, my girlfriend and I will be staying in a dark spot where we should be able to see 84, hopefully it's still doing OK...

[edit 2] Decayed so far:

25, 72, 14 may

13, 29 april

94, 18 april

19, 7 april

Started to decay:

68, 10 may

21, 3 may

72, 27 april

25, 19 april

All decayed: 25, 72, 13, 94, 19, 23, 49, 43, 3, 34, 6, 8, 30, 77, 74.

It appears to take between two to four weeks for an Iridium satellite to decay from the start of the deorbiting process.

An interesting fact is why the name Iridium? When they were in the planning stages for this set of satellites, they estimated that they would need 77 of them to completely cover the Earth (including the poles), evoking an image of 77 electrons circling the nucleus of an atom. The atomic number for the element Iridium is 77. The number of satellites needed was paired down to 66, so the satellites should actually be na…

Does the tracker actually model the directed reflections or just the relative angle of the viewer, the satellite and the sun and let chance take care of the rest?

IIRC it is a fairly precise model. They know which antennas, and the directed reflection. The width ground track is not all that wide, but if you're right in the middle of it they're very bright. Years ago I drove to be in the center of the path and could easily see the flare in broad daylight.

They might still be there for a while, just not predictable. Which might make them a bit more special.

Apparently they will all be taken down by the end of the year. It was posted on HN a while back. I'm not sure why this current article seems unaware of these plans.

According to Wikipedia there are a few in uncontrolled orbits, so they might be around for a while yet. As for the ones still under control, it looks like they'll drop 15-20km below their replacements as a contingency for a little while, before finally being de-orbited (I can't find any details on the timing for this)
